Ten Years of Teen Safe Driving Advocacy

December 2, 2016 marked ten years since the passing of 17-year-old Reid Hollister in a traffic crash.  Since that time, Reid’s father, Tim Hollister of Hartford, CT, has been a tireless advocate for safer teen driving, a blogger, an author and a friend of The Gillen Group. We are privileged to support him and help share his story.

Tim’s advocacy work has received national public service awards from the U.S. Department of Transportation, the Governors Highway Safety Association, and the National Safety Council.

In his latest blog post, “Ten Years, Ten Questions: A Reflection of Safe Driving Advocacy", Tim shares what he has learned through the last ten years of advocating for safer driving for teens and all drivers. He leaves his readers with ten questions to start them thinking about where the line is being drawn today between freedom and safety.

It’s been a long and grief-filled road for Tim, and in 2017 he will be stepping back from his safe teen driving advocacy work and moving on to other challenges. Tim, however, remains hopeful for the future of teen driver safety in knowing that the many traffic safety advocates he has met along the way will continue fighting for this issue to make our roads a safer place. Do you have holiday parties to attend this season? We know that the holidays are known for being merry and bright, but they’re also known for being the deadliest season when it comes to drunk driving. Every holiday season, lives are lost due to drunk driving. The Gillen Group encourages you to be safe and not get behind the wheel after you’ve been drinking.   

If you’re heading out to celebrate the season, have a plan to get home safe. Call a cab, take an Uber, Lyft or other similar service, or have a designated driver.

If you live in the Washington DC metro area, take advantage of The Washington Regional Alcohol Program’s (WRAP) SoberRide campaign and call a free taxi!

The 2016 Holiday SoberRide program will be offered from 10:00 pm to 6:00 am nightly starting Friday, December 16 through Sunday, January 1, 2017. To receive a free cab ride home, call 800-200-8294 (TAXI).  AT&T customers may dial #WRAP from their wireless phones.  Click here for more information.

Celebrating 20 Years of Safe Kids Buckle Up

The Gillen Group would like to congratulate Safe Kids Worldwide on two incredible events this month – the 20th anniversary of the Safe Kids Buckle Up campaign and their Safe Roads, Safe Kids Summit. We were honored to attend both events and are grateful for all they have done to prevent childhood injuries and deaths worldwide.

On December 6, Safe Kids celebrated the 20th anniversary of their partnership with General Motors on their Safe Kids Buckle Up campaign at a reception at the Newseum in Washington, DC. Through this campaign Safe Kids Worldwide has advocated for stronger car seat and booster seat laws, donated over 698,000 car seats to families in need, educated families through more than two million car seat seats and so much more.

On December 8 and 9, Safe Kids hosted their Safe Roads, Safe Kids Summit at the JW Marriott Hotel in Washington, DC.  The Summit is designed to enhance the visibility of global road safety and to reduce the number of deaths and injuries among children.
